Huh? How do those mount? Is there no blts to the pinch weld?
No there are no bolts to the pinch weld. The pinch weld sits in the channel on the brackets. There are three of these brackets and two brackets one in the rear and one in the front on the outside above the pinch weld total of 5. Not sure if I can explain it right here but the way its designed it does use the pinch weld and rocker and pretty much a lot of the jeep for support to make it solid. I jumped up and down on the tub and I'm 200LBS and that's the weakest part of the sliders they never moved. I also jacked the jeep up from the center of the tube which is a lot of pressure in a small area and they didn't move again.
